Search jobs > Cary, NC > Stack engineer

Full Stack Engineer - Associate

B264 DB Global Technology, Inc.
Cary, 3000 CentreGreen Way
$85K-$120.8K a year
Full-time

Description

Job Title Full Stack Engineer

Corporate Title Associate

Location Cary, NC

Who we are

In short an essential part of Deutsche Bank’s technology solution, developing applications for key business areas.

Our Technologists drive Cloud, Cyber and business technology strategy while transforming it within a robust, hands-on engineering culture.

Learning is a key element of our people strategy, and we have a variety of options for you to develop professionally. Our approach to the future of work champions flexibility and is rooted in the understanding that there have been dramatic shifts in the ways we work.

Having first established a presence in the Americas in the 19th century, Deutsche Bank opened its US technology center in Cary, North Carolina in 2009. Learn more about us .

Overview

Corporate Bank Technology has embarked on a multi-year technology refresh program that includes revitalization of "Channel" applications for payment initiation.

As a Senior Engineer, you will be working on driving the development of global payment initiation platform that has React based micro frontends backed by Java powered micro-services deployed in a containerized environment.

The platform has on-prem and Google cloud hosted components, and the technology stack includes open-source software hosted on Google Cloud platform, react based User Interface (UI), event streaming over Kafka, Workflow orchestration using Temporal io and datastores such as PostgreSQL, Oracle, MongoDB.

You'll collaborate with other Senior Engineers, Lead Engineers and Analysts on the platform embracing agile practices to incrementally add functionality, with a sharp focus on automation.

You will also partner with Business and technology managers to define modules and enhancements to the application stack that provides Deutsche Bank's institutional clients ability to initiate payments in real time.

What We Offer You

  • A diverse and inclusive environment that embraces change, innovation, and collaboration
  • A hybrid working model with up to 60% work from home, allowing for in-office / work from home flexibility, generous vacation, personal and volunteer days : A commitment to .
  • Employee Resource Groups support an inclusive workplace for everyone and promote community engagement : Access to a strong network of Communities of Practice connecting you to colleagues with shared interests and values
  • Competitive compensation packages including health and wellbeing benefits, retirement savings plans, parental leave, and family building benefits
  • Educational resources, matching gift, and volunteer programs

What You’ll Do

  • Accountable for engineering and leading functional deliveries in Corporate Bank Technology
  • Deliver state of the art solutions and be a hands-on technologist
  • Implement leading technology advancements in the industry, maintain hygiene, risk, control, and stability at the core of every delivery
  • Manage the software development life cycle (SDLC) of software components all the way to production, including helping support the application to resolve production issues with appropriate triaging
  • Partner with User Interface / User Experience (UI / UX) Design Team, Architects, Business Analysts, and Stakeholders situated in multiple regions and time-zones;

at varying capacity to understand requirements

Skills You’ll Need

  • Extensive experience developing Java based Microservices (preferably using Spring Boot framework)
  • Extensive experience working with relational datastore such as PostgreSQL, Oracle and non-relational datastores such as MongoDB
  • Relevant experience in Cloud distributed computing especially with demonstrable use of GKE, GCP Cloud Run
  • Relevant frontend development experience using React JS, TypeScript, CSS, Node.JS and Redux
  • Experience with workflow managers like Temporal

Skills That Will Help You Excel

  • Bachelors or Masters (preferred) degree in the field of computer science and / or technology
  • Cloud Engineering Skills and Certifications
  • Experience with Git, Nx, npm, Gradle, Github Actions, CI / CD tools
  • Exposure to Splunk / Structured Query Language for data analysis
  • Full understanding of SDLC lifecycle for software delivery including engaging with production support personnel for defect triaging and resolution

Expectations

It is the Bank’s expectation that employees hired into this role will work in the Cary office in accordance with the Bank’s hybrid working model.

Deutsche Bank provides reasonable accommodations to candidates and employees with a substantiated need based on disability and / or religion.

The salary range for this position in Cary is $85,000 to $120,750. Actual salaries may be based on a number of factors including, but not limited to, a candidate’s skill set, experience, education, work location and other qualifications.

Posted salary ranges do not include incentive compensation or any other type of remuneration.

Deutsche Bank Values & Diversity

We believe talent is found in all cultures, countries, races, ethnicities, genders, sexual orientations, disabilities, beliefs, generations, backgrounds, and experiences.

We pursue a working environment where everyone can be authentic and feel a sense of belonging. Click to find out more about our diversity and inclusion efforts.

We are an Equal Opportunity Employer - Veterans / Disabled and other protected categories.

Click these links to view the following notices : and ; ; and

Learn more about your life at Deutsche Bank through the eyes of our current employees :

The California Consumer Privacy Act outlines how companies can use personal information. If you are interested in receiving a copy of Deutsche Bank’s California Privacy Notice, please email .

Deutsche Bank Benefits

At Deutsche Bank, we recognize that our benefit programs have a profound impact on our colleagues. That’s why we are focused on providing benefits and perks that enable our colleagues to live authenti cally and be their whole selves, at every stage of life.

We provide access to physical, emotional, and financial wellness benefits that allow our colleagues to stay financially secure and strike balance between work and home. Click to learn more!

Click these links to view the following notices : and ; ; and

LI-HYBRID

LI-REMOTE

LI-ONSITE

Our values define the working environment we strive to create diverse, supportive and welcoming of different views. We embrace a culture reflecting a variety of perspectives, insights and backgrounds to drive innovation.

We build talented and diverse teams to drive business results and encourage our people to develop to their full potential.

Talk to us about flexible work arrangements and other initiatives we offer.

We promote good working relationships and encourage high standards of conduct and work performance.

30+ days ago
Related jobs
B264 DB Global Technology, Inc.
Cary, North Carolina

You'll collaborate with other Senior Engineers, Lead Engineers and Analysts on the platform embracing agile practices to incrementally add functionality, with a sharp focus on automation. Our Technologists drive Cloud, Cyber and business technology strategy while transforming it within a robust, han...

Aditi Consulting
Durham, North Carolina

The client is looking for an expert Senior Full Stack Engineer to join us in the design and development of innovative technology for financial advisors and their clients using the latest technology stack in a collaborative and engaging environment. Sophisticated full stack software development exper...

flyiin GmbH
Raleigh, North Carolina

Full Stack Engineer - Mid/Senior ($120-$150k)Vetspire - Remote USA/Canada. Proven experience as a Full Stack Developer or similar role. Scroll down to find the complete details of the job offer, including experience required and associated duties and tasks. ...

Yoh
Durham, North Carolina

Full Stack Engineer (Java NodeJS) Hybrid NC W2 Only. Bachelor's degree in Computer Science, Software Engineering or related field. ...

Games Jobs Direct
Cary, North Carolina

Epic Games is looking for a Senior Full-Stack Engineer to join the Service Management Platform team to work directly on our service management platform based on Backstage. A Full-Stack role would mean working and owning the full-service delivery process of the platform - configuring development tool...

Splunk Inc
North Carolina, United States

Backend/Full-stack Software Engineer. A Bachelor's, Master's, or PhD in Computer Science, Software Engineering, Computer Engineering, Electrical Engineering, Mathematics or a related technical field, and a strong record of academic achievement. You will also work with other engineering teams across ...

Piper Companies
Durham, North Carolina

Responsibilities for the Senior Full Stack Engineer:. Qualifications for the Senior Full Stack Engineer:. Compensation for the Senior Full Stack Engineer:. Full Stack Development, Java, Angular, Spring Boot, Microservices, AWS, Kubernetes, Docker, CI/CD, UI, Front end, Back end, middle-tier, develop...

Broadcom Inc.
Durham, North Carolina

As an R&D Software Engineer you will be responsible for working closely with management and architects to create highly complex and sophisticated software on design projects that span several groups. Mentor, train, develop and serve as knowledge resource for less experienced Software Engineers. ...

BAE Systems
Durham, North Carolina

As a member of our Full Stack development team, you will collaborate with our software architects, research scientists, and data scientists to design and develop novel, interactive data processing and visualizations that bridge the gap between human users and state of the art machine learning algori...

Accentuate Staffing
Raleigh, North Carolina

Proficient in C# and experience building full-stack web applications using modern frameworks like ASP. Work with a team of engineers to build and deploy scalable and reliable systems. ...